基于Grafana与Prometheus的大数据实时监控技术实现
基于Grafana与Prometheus的大数据实时监控技术实现
在大数据时代,实时监控系统对于企业而言至关重要。通过实时监控,企业可以快速发现和解决问题,确保系统的稳定性和性能。Grafana和Prometheus作为目前最流行的监控工具组合,为企业提供了强大的实时监控解决方案。本文将深入探讨如何基于Grafana和Prometheus实现大数据实时监控技术。
1. Grafana与Prometheus简介
Grafana是一个功能强大的开源监控和数据可视化平台,支持多种数据源,能够将复杂的数据转化为直观的图表。Prometheus则是一个开源的监控和报警工具,以其强大的查询语言PromQL和灵活的扩展性著称。
两者结合使用,可以实现高效的数据监控和可视化。Prometheus负责数据的采集和存储,而Grafana则负责数据的可视化展示,为企业提供了一个完整的监控解决方案。
2. 大数据实时监控的实现步骤
要基于Grafana和Prometheus实现大数据实时监控,通常需要以下步骤:
- 数据采集: 使用Prometheus的 exporters 采集系统数据,如CPU、内存、磁盘使用率等。
- 数据传输: 通过HTTP协议将采集到的数据传输到Prometheus服务器。
- 数据存储: Prometheus将采集到的数据存储在本地磁盘或分布式存储系统中。
- 数据可视化: 在Grafana中创建 dashboard,通过PromQL 查询数据并展示为图表。
3. 关键技术点
在实现基于Grafana和Prometheus的实时监控系统时,需要注意以下关键点:
- 数据采集的实现: 确保数据采集的准确性和实时性,可以通过配置Prometheus的 scrape 配置来实现。
- 数据传输的协议: 使用HTTP协议进行数据传输,确保数据传输的稳定性和安全性。
- 数据存储的选择: 根据实际需求选择合适的存储方案,如本地存储或分布式存储。
- 数据可视化的配置: 在Grafana中合理配置 dashboard,选择合适的图表类型以展示数据。
4. 实现优势
基于Grafana和Prometheus的实时监控系统具有以下优势:
- 高效的数据处理: Prometheus的高效数据采集和存储机制,确保了实时监控的响应速度。
- 灵活的配置: Grafana和Prometheus都支持高度可配置的监控方案,能够满足不同企业的需求。
- 高扩展性: 系统支持横向扩展,能够适应企业数据规模的增长。
- 实时监控与告警: 系统能够实时监控数据,并通过告警机制及时通知管理员。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。